Bonhams and Butterfield was a large American auction house, founded in 1865 by, William Butterfield in San Francisco.

It was purchased in 1999 from Bernard Osher by online auctioneer eBay for $260 million.

In 2002, it was acquired from eBay by British auctioneer Bonhams and operated under the: name Bonhams & Butterfields for about ten years. It now just goes by Bonhams.
